Advanced Radar Features and Data Interpretation
Advanced features of the Hagerstown, MD weather radar provide more detailed insights into weather conditions, moving beyond basic precipitation intensity. One such feature is velocity data, which reveals the wind speed and direction within a storm. This data helps meteorologists identify rotation in thunderstorms, a key indicator of potential tornadoes. Examining velocity data can significantly improve your understanding of a storm’s severity and potential hazards.
Another crucial feature is dual-polarization technology. Traditional radar sends out a single pulse of energy. Dual-polarization radar sends out both horizontal and vertical pulses. By comparing the returned signals, this advanced technology can differentiate between different types of precipitation, such as rain, snow, hail, and even insects. This distinction enhances the accuracy of precipitation estimates and improves the ability to issue timely and accurate warnings.
Interpreting storm reports is equally important when using advanced radar features. The National Weather Service (NWS) collects reports from trained spotters and the public, providing on-the-ground verification of radar data. Comparing radar data with storm reports can help to confirm the accuracy of radar interpretations and identify potential hazards that might not be visible on the radar alone. These reports often include information about hail size, wind damage, and flooding, adding crucial context to the radar data.
Understanding radar artifacts can also prevent misinterpretations. Radar images can sometimes show artifacts, which are false echoes that can be caused by ground clutter, radio interference, or other factors. These artifacts can be distinguished from actual precipitation by their appearance and behavior. By familiarizing yourself with common radar artifacts, you can avoid making incorrect conclusions about weather conditions.
Utilizing radar for specific weather scenarios allows for tailored interpretations. For example, during winter storms, it is essential to look for the melting layer, which is the boundary between snow and rain. The radar can often identify this layer, helping to predict whether precipitation will fall as snow, sleet, or freezing rain. This information is crucial for planning travel and other activities during winter weather.

Understanding the different types of weather alerts is crucial for effective preparedness. A watch means that conditions are favorable for a certain type of weather event, and it's important to stay informed. A warning means that a weather event is imminent or occurring, and you should take immediate action to protect yourself. Knowing the difference can save lives.
